Search Engine Optimization (SEO) ‘Search Engine Optimisation (SEO) is the process of designing or making alterations to a website in such a way that the search engines can find and index the given website with greater ease, resulting in improved rankings” (Visser & Weideman, 2011, p. 7).
History of SEO Brian Pinkerton – The WebCrawler Inventor “Brian Pinkerton created the WebCrawler in April 20, 1994 … It was the first of its kind, providing full-text search results”WebCrawler Danny Sullivan – The Faithful Search Evangelist “Sullivan founded the Search Engine Watch in 1997, even before Google was founded 1998 as a company. He is also the founding editor of Search Engine Land”Search Engine WatchSearch Engine Land Larry Page and Sergey Brin – The Google Guys “They developed a better system to determine the relevance of a website using the number of pages and the authority of the pages that link to the original website. It then ranks the pages based on their score. ” (Boateng, 2013, p.1)Boateng
